What Are The Health Benefits Of Walking 10,000 Steps A Day
Walking regularly and aiming for about 10,000 steps can deliver many benefits for the body and mind. Don’t trust just because we say it. Trust because the researchers say it:
-
Better heart health and lower disease risk: As per Harvard, a large review of more than 160,000 people found that about 7,000–10,000 steps daily significantly reduce risk of cardiovascular disease, stroke and early death.
-
Helps manage weight by burning calories: Walking 10,000 steps may burn 300–500 calories depending on pace and body. That helps those focused on calories burned or following a weight watchers plan.
-
Better metabolism and blood-sugar control: In the words of the Indian Express, regular walking improves insulin sensitivity and overall metabolic function, reducing risk of type 2 diabetes.
-
Cuts early death risk: A 2024 British Journal of Sports Medicine study found that walking 9,000–10,500 steps daily cuts early-death risk by 39% and heart-attack or stroke risk by 21%, with benefits starting above 2,200 steps.
-
Better bone remodeling (improved bone-health markers) via walking + joint exercise in adults: A randomized controlled trial among menopausal women found that walking (plus joint exercises) significantly increased bone mineral density (BMD) and improved bone-remodeling biomarkers such as estrogen, while reducing bone-resorption markers (like RANKL, PTH).
-
Strengthened muscles, preserved joint flexibility and improved stamina: A classic analysis by PubMed described walking as an aerobic activity using large skeletal muscles that, over time, “strengthens muscles of the legs, limb girdle and lower trunk, preserves flexibility of major joints,” improving posture and general endurance.

The Guide To Pick the Right Shoes For Walking 10,000 Steps A Day
If you’re serious about hitting 10,000 steps a day, you need the right shoes on your side. Sounds simple, but trust me, the wrong pair can make even a 5-minute walk feel like a punishment, while the right pair can make your whole fitness routine smooth, fun, and pain-free.
When you walk this much, every step counts. So let’s break down how to choose the best shoes for walking 10,000 steps a day, in the simplest way possible.
1. Cushioning, Softness & Shock Absorption
When you’re walking 10,000 steps, your feet hit the ground thousands of times. That impact travels straight to your knees, hips, and back. That’s why you need soft cushioned shoes, a supportive midsole, and a proper shock absorber sole.
This helps reduce impact, makes your stride gentler, and lets you walk longer without feeling beaten up. If getting fit is your goal, then getting the best daily walking cushioned shoes for long walks will help you in walking 10,000 steps everyday, without joint pain slowing you down.
2. Light Weight & All-Day Comfort
Heavy shoes feel fine initially… until your legs start getting tired halfway through your walk.
Go for light weight, comfortable sneakers that don’t drag your feet down.
Light shoes make speed walking easier, help you move with better rhythm, and keep your step goals on track. They’re also great if you’re tracking your recommended walking distance per day and want a pair that supports you, not slows you.
3. Breathability & Sweat-Absorbing Materials
If you live in a warm or humid area (hello, Indian summers!), always choose breathable walking shoes. Mesh uppers, tiny air channels, and sweat absorbing linings keep your feet cool and dry.
This matters a lot, especially if you walk outdoors or cover long distances. Breathable shoes also feel fresher and prevent overheating, which most walkers don’t realize makes a huge difference.
4. Proper Fit & Good Arch Support
Your shoes should fit well, not too tight, not too loose. Walkers need a snug heel, a roomy toe box, and soft but supportive footbeds. Proper arch support prevents heel pain, arch strain, and that burning feeling under your foot during long walks.
It also corrects your posture naturally, which helps with stamina and reduces soreness. Whether you're hitting the best footwear for walking or choosing the best daily walking shoes, always start with fit and arch support.
5. Flexibility + Stability = Perfect Walking Support
Your walking shoes should feel stable but still move naturally with your feet.
Look for:
-
A firm, stable heel
-
A flexible forefoot (so your toes can bend naturally)
-
A supportive midsole that keeps your gait aligned
This combo gives you overall support for walking, whether it’s long slow walks, brisk walks, or shoes for speed walking.
Good flexibility lets your feet roll smoothly. Good stability keeps you balanced. Together, they help you stay consistent with your health and fitness journey and track progress through smart watches, step counters, and calories burned trackers.
6. Durability & Made For Indian Weather
If you walk every day, you need shoes that can survive everyday use and our changing Indian weather. Pick footwear with long-lasting soles, strong stitching, and materials that don’t break down easily in heat, humidity, and dust.
Durable shoes matter when you're picking the best footwear for walking, especially for long-term routines like counting steps or following weight watchers fitness plans.

2. How important is it to have a comfortable pair of shoes to reach your step goals?
Very important. Good footwear reduces fatigue, protects your joints, and helps you stay consistent.
3. What are the possible cons of not wearing the right shoes for walking long distances?
Wearing the wrong shoes can lead to sore feet, blisters, knee pain, and even long-term issues like plantar fasciitis. Basically, bad shoes steal the joy out of walking and make sticking to 10,000 steps way harder.
